The Role of Refrigeration Systems in Maintaining Quality for Dairy Products
Refrigeration systems play a crucial role in the dairy industry, ensuring the quality and safety of dairy products from farm to consumer. With the sensitivity of dairy products to temperature changes, effective refrigeration is essential for maintaining freshness, flavor, and nutritional value.
Dairy products such as milk, cheese, yogurt, and ice cream have specific temperature requirements for storage and transportation. Typically, these products must be kept at temperatures below 40°F (4°C) to inhibit the growth of harmful bacteria. Advanced refrigeration systems not only regulate these temperatures but also provide consistency throughout the production process.
One of the key responsibilities of refrigeration systems is to prevent spoilage. Fresh milk can spoil quickly if not stored properly, leading to waste and potential health risks. By utilizing efficient cooling technology, dairy producers can extend the shelf life of their products. This extended freshness contributes not only to consumer satisfaction but also to profitability for dairy businesses.
Moreover, refrigeration systems enhance the quality of dairy products by preserving flavor and texture. For instance, cheese benefits from being aged at specific temperatures and humidity levels, which can be maintained through precise refrigeration. This careful control ensures that the cheese develops its intended flavor profile, texture, and aroma, which are vital for consumer enjoyment.
Transportation of dairy products is another area where refrigeration systems shine. Refrigerated trucks equipped with reliable cooling technology transport dairy goods across long distances. This ensures that the product remains at optimal temperatures, minimizing the risk of spoilage and maintaining quality during transit. Advanced logistics and real-time temperature monitoring systems are increasingly being used to enhance this process further.
Additionally, advancements in refrigeration technology, such as the use of solar-powered coolers and energy-efficient compressors, are making it easier for dairy farms to operate sustainably. These innovations not only reduce carbon footprints but also lower energy costs, enhancing the overall efficiency of dairy production.
